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 12 ACMG points: 12P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Moderate
The NM_002294.3(LAMP2):c.788delG(p.Gly263fs) variant causes a frameshift change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(★).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

LAMP2 (HGNC:6501): (lysosomal associated membrane protein 2)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of a family of membrane glycoproteins. This glycoprotein provides selectins with carbohydrate ligands. It may play a role in tumor cell metastasis. It may also function in the protection, maintenance, and adhesion of the lysosome. Alternative splicing of this gene results in multiple transcript variants encoding distinct proteins.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Pathogenic,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Labcorp | Oct 03, 2016 | For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. While this particular variant has not been reported in the literature, loss-of-function variants in LAMP2 are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 21415759). This sequence change deletes 1 nucleotide from exon 6 of the LAMP2 mRNA (c.788delG), causing a frameshift at codon 263. This cre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Gly263Alafs*20) and is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. - |
